Sean Michael Sweeney is a dedicated attorney based in Akron, Ohio, specializing in Insurance and Personal Injury law. As the founder of The Sweeney Law Firm, LLC, he brings over two decades of legal experience to his practice, providing compassionate and effective representation for clients navigating complex legal challenges. A graduate of Cleveland State University’s Cleveland-Marshall College of Law, Sean earned his Juris Doctor in 1999, building a solid foundation in legal principles that guide his practice today. Prior to establishing his own firm in 2015, he honed his skills as Counsel at Moscarino @ Treu and as an Associate at Reminger, where he gained invaluable experience in handling a diverse range of cases. Sean’s commitment to excellence has not gone unnoticed; he was awarded the prestigious Peer Review Rated designation by Martindale-Hubbell in 2019, reflecting his high ethical standards and professionalism within the legal community. His academic achievements, including receiving the highest grade in Torts during law school, underscore his expertise in navigating the intricacies of insurance claims and personal injury litigation. About Personal Injury Law
Personal injury attorneys represent individuals who have been injured due to the negligence of others. They work to obtain comp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ering. Common matters include car accidents, slip and fall, medical malpractice, workplace injuries.
